Onboarding note for the Ledgerpane admin table: bulk edits are applied through the batcher service, not directly against the database. Select rows, choose an action, and the batcher stages changes in a pending set you can review before commit. Edits over 500 rows require a second approver — this is enforced server-side, so don't try to chunk around it. To run the batcher locally you need the staging write credential, which goes in your .env as the next line.

secret setting of bahip-kagag: RELAY_SECRET3=c83

**Checklist item 7 — Verify digest scheduling hooks (plugin authors).** Before publishing against the Mailloom v4 release, confirm your plugin registers its batch digest schedule via the new `onDigestWindow` hook rather than the deprecated cron shim. Test with at least one daily and one weekly window, and verify timezone normalization against the Tarnholm staging cluster. Plugins that skip this step may silently drop digests for users west of UTC. Record your test run alongside the release's trace token, which appears immediately below.

trace token, kawip-fafog: htk14_26e64c4d35154e

## Formula sandbox tuning

User-supplied formulas in Gridmoor execute inside a restricted interpreter with hard ceilings on time, memory, and call depth. Reviewers should confirm any change to these ceilings is justified in the PR description, since raising them widens the abuse surface. Defaults were chosen from production traces. The current limits are as follows.

limits module of tafog-fawip:
WEIGHTS = {
    "julix": 57,
    "lamys": 992,
    "kasvan": 209,
    "quenok": 750,
    "alddor": 259,
    "oliath": 1009,
    "wenix": 815,
}

Action item from the Snackline postmortem (owner: on-call). The restock planner generated duplicate routes on the morning of the incident because the depot inventory snapshot was read twice under retry. Until the idempotency fix ships, verify route counts against the depot dashboard before dispatch each morning, and cancel duplicates manually if the counts diverge. The manual cancellation procedure and dashboard walkthrough are documented on the internal page below.

wiki page, bagaf-fawip: https://harbor.tolvaqsys.local/pages/repo/pages/secrets/eac969ffc71f356b